Before anything: dont let the rating i put for the quality and and explaination turn you away. This really is worth the little bit of time and practice needed.

A quick background story about me: when I found out about this trick, I considered myself a card magician... And that was about it. But ever since I learned this trick, this has been my #1 go-to effect! Even more so than any card trick or mind reading, etc. This one has fooled laymen and magicians alike when I've performed it.

The major plus side to this trick is: not only does this trick use money (something that everyone can relate to and almost always carries on them... And they're bills, not coins, so even more people carry your props on them), but they're borrowed props! This means that this trick is more personal than most tricks out there... aside from maybe mind reading and telling someone about something personal to the.

This is one of those tricks that are great because not only can you have absolutely no props on you, but it's a reputation maker. In a close up situation, this can be one of the best tricks you can do. While Andrew Mayne teaches this trick done at eye level, from my recollection, he also teaches the handling done at waist level, which I feel is more natural. And at waist level, this trick can easily be done surrounded! And the only real sleight or misdirection used during the trick is done at the very beginning... right in front of the spectator! It goes right over their heads! In fact, sometimes I forget that I do the move myself. It's so natural.

In my opinion, this trick is something like a pen through bill trick, just better, because EVERYTHING is borrowed and is fully examinable. No funny moves. Nothing to hide or cover. Nothing to add on or palm out. And can be repeated if need be.

All in all, if I had to do or recommend one trick, this would be it!

Pros
It's an easy and amazing effect with BORROWED bills! For the lack of props needed, the simplicity of the handling, and the strength of the overall effect, this is a must have!
Cons
There's only so much you can do in this trick with the principal that's taught.

I also didn't like all the covering that Andrew did with this effect. I just went and took all of the overall covering that he did out... And it gave me an even more visual aspect to the trick.
